School-Linked Services

School-Linked Services PDF Author: Laura R. Bronstein
Publisher: Columbia University Press
ISBN: 0231541775
Category : Social Science
Languages : en
Pages : 333

Book Description
The evidence-based strategies in this volume close the achievement gap among students from all sociological backgrounds. Designed according to local needs assessments, they provide the services, programs, initiatives, and relationships that are crucial for children's success in school and life. These practices and programs include afterschool and summer sessions, early-childhood education, school-linked health and mental health services, family engagement, and youth leadership opportunities. This book addresses the policy and funding requirements that help these partnerships thrive and offers effective counterarguments against those who would question their value. The text describes strategies that work in both rural and urban contexts and includes a chapter evaluating school-community partnerships across the world. Because it involves collaborations across professions and organizations, the book's interdisciplinary approach will appeal to those in social work, education, psychology, public health, counseling, nursing, and public policy.

Principles of Human Services

Principles of Human Services PDF Author: Sharleen L. Kato
Publisher: Goodheart-Wilcox Publisher
ISBN: 9781645647966
Category :
Languages : en
Pages : 560

Book Description
As the only text of its kind on the market, Principles of Human Services is an overview designed to help the human services workers of tomorrow explore the rewards and responsibilities of potential careers in a variety of human services. Coverage includes a comprehensive introduction to five human services pathways along with the rewards, demands, and trends associated with the various careers. The pathways include consumer services, personal care services, family and community services, counseling and mental health services, and early childhood development and services. Additionally, human services-related careers in food and nutrition, clothing, and housing and interior design are included. Throughout this text, students will examine all aspects of best practices vital to human services professions. They will develop an understanding of the aptitudes, attitudes, and skills; education and training; and specialized knowledge needed to succeed in a wide variety of human services careers. Likewise, students will also discover which careers are expected to experience growth in the future. By studying this text, workers of tomorrow will delve deeper into the world of the human services profession.
